Also – I just remember hearing a Celtic guitar accompanist saying that you can say the following words to a slip jig, “buy the band a beer, buy the band a beer, buy the band a beer”. (Specific instructions – say the five words over about 1 second and repeat = a fast slip jig)

I have a question about the high 2 ascending and low 2 descending you suggest in the basic melody tutorial of forked deer. It sounds plain wrong to me. Is it a sin to always play the low 2 that I’d like to hear? What’s fiddling tradition did the high 2 come from?
